## Deploying the Harvestlink Gateway

Welcome aboard! The Harvestlink gateway collects tractor and combine telemetry from the Brindle Hollow test farms and ships it upstream. Deploys are simple: build the container, push to the internal registry, and roll the fleet one node at a time. Before your first deploy, double-check the runtime settings, which are as follows.

deployment values, kajep-kageg:
[praix]
host = praix.paliqcorp.corp
user = praix_svc
database = praix_prod

RUNBOOK 4.2 — Safe lock replacement, Brackwell site. Replacement lock unit arrives via Stonegate Couriers, window 09:00–11:00. Receiving: confirm tamper tape intact, photograph all six faces of the crate, log weight against manifest. Do not open; the fitter from Ashvane Locks opens on site. Stage crate in secure cage B, lights on, camera coverage verified. Escalate any seal damage to the duty officer before acceptance. Courier hand-over requires the phrase recorded below.

handover note for tadug-yaguf: the aldath pelwyn courier leaves the casox norwyn briix silok zorok kasdor aldion quenox ledger at gate 2653 under passcode 959015

Finance Review Summary — Reseller Programme, Kestrel Forge Ltd

Reseller revenue up 12% year on year; margin down two points due to tiered rebates. Fourteen active partners; three underperforming and flagged for exit. Programme administration costs remain within budget. Recommendation: consolidate tiers next quarter. The confidential note below details the related business plans.

internal memo for yahag-tahog: The pricing group signed off on a budget of $152.8 million for Project Soriel.

Subject: Handover — Gaugewick sidecar release duties

Hi Tamsin,

Passing you the Gaugewick metrics-aggregation sidecar releases. For plugin authors: the sidecar loads only signed plugins, and the ABI is frozen until the next major. Release cadence is biweekly; compatibility notes go in the plugin portal before each tag. Plugins must be verified against the sidecar's signing key, reproduced below.

rollout seal: bky3_eGt